  <dc:title>Letter, from Edward Sabine to Sir John Herschel, dated at Woolwich</dc:title>
  <dc:description>Autograph letter signed by sender. Saw [J. B.] Listing, who may see John Frederick William Herschel soon. Sends volume of Cape magnetic observations. Thermometer at Kew is a great success. New thermometers compare favorably with [Henri] Regnault's.</dc:description>
  <dc:date>7 October 1851</dc:date>
